Description 

Climb left side of Lost Face on delicate holds with out use of corner. Surmont Lost Face Overhang II and up.

I can't say for a fact that these are indeed First Ascents. I can only state they are attractive nice lines that do not appear in Swartling's guide. They were done in the spirit of "fair play" and were duly documented.


Protection 

Standard Rack
